Kayla Churchill: Senior Class President

This article is written by a student writer from the Her Campus at UNCW chapter.

Name: Kayla Marie Churchill

Hometown: Emerald Isle, North Carolina

Year: Senior

Major: Political Science major with a minor in Pre-law and English

 

For Seahawk Seniors who don’t already know, Kayla Churchill is the Senior Class President.  Aside from keeping up with her classes and being the face for the senior student body, Kayla is actively involved in several other organizations on campus, as well.  She is a member of the Eta Xi chapter of the Alpha Phi Fraternity, an Engagement Guide at the Office of Student Leadership and Engagement, a member of the Campus Outreach Council and an active member of Order of Omega.

When Kayla is not on campus, she can be found volunteering for local organization such as the Brigade Boys and Girls Club, the Good Shepherd Center and several senior homes in the community.  Through her job at the Office of Student Leadership and Engagement, Kayla is currently taking part in a program call “Angel Tree” where she and her partner, Vanessa Kopp, arrange for underprivileged children in the community to receive Christmas gifts.

Kayla says, “I really enjoy being involved both on and off campus because it is a constant reminder of how truly blessed I am. By volunteering, I am repeatedly humbled by the people I come into contact with. I also enjoy being involved, because I truly like to do as much as I can for others and myself.  I always push myself to do more, hence why I am so involved.”

In her free time, Kayla enjoys playing volleyball, spending time with her friends and family, traveling and shopping.  After graduation she plans to attend law school and become an attorney in sports and entertainment.  It sounds to me like UNCW has its very own Elle Woods :)

Her favorite quote:

“Never doubt that a small group of thoughtful, committed, citizens can change the world. Indeed, it is the only thing that ever has.”  -Margaret Mead
